I'm a newbie so please bear with me. I uploaded a PNG file and using the Pixel Persona, I started filling color in using the Flood Fill Tool. However, I'm getting these grey spots around the black pixel lines.  The image is 300 DPI.  Also, I've played with the tolerance slider but can't get it to be perfect.  Please see attached image. Any advice to achieve a proper color fill would be greatly appreciated. Thank you as always.

You may want to use a completely different workflow.
If your PNG is just black/grayscale anyway:

  1. create a red Fill layer
  2. put it behind your PNG layer as background
  3. set the PNG blend mode to Multiply
